Output 34074f17892a729fa301b3276af596a166778e200dc574f12920d1f10e3c5013:17

value
615345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4611ae4b674204b403d801f55aa9104d948c7873 OP_EQUAL
address
385WQTX8T1fsNE5EjuNjo8Qg3h8c4BCyex
transaction
34074f17892a729fa301b3276af596a166778e200dc574f12920d1f10e3c5013
spent
true